Don't Better Homes and Gardens specials (and several British magazines) do 
something this? You read an article extolling the virtues of a plant and 
then at the bottom there's a "special offer" for "our readers." The 
articles always seem okay but I wonder if the authors have to avoid 
mentioning troubles like mildew when the story is really a conduit for sales.

> > I am sorry to hear about your situation, Doreen.  I am curious about what
> > you said in terms of "using branding in an article".  Does that mean the
> > gardening article mentions a product, such as an herb seed mat, not just as
> > information but because the company making the mats paid to have the 
> mention
> > in the article?  I remember a guy in Texas, years ago, that sold that kind
> > of arrangement to companies.  If you gave him $2000 or something like that,
> > he mentioned your product in his syndicated column.  From what you say, the
> > Woman's Day thing goes further.  It sounds like they are then selling the
> > herb seed mat at the end of the article.  Can you clarify that part of the
> > deal?
>
>It would appear that this is a blurring of the line between content and
>advertising in a magazine, and, as such, is patently dishonest.  Shame on
>everyone involved.
